Shanghai Volkswagen Automotive Co., Ltd. (SVW) will suspend the production of Santana in 2012, said sources.
As a veteran brand, Santana witnessed the growth of the Chinese automobile market. When Dongfeng Peugeot Citroen Automobile Co., Ltd. (DPCA) suspended the production of Fukang, another earliest domestic nameplate, analysts questioned about the lifecycle of Santana, as well as Jetta, the trademark owned by FAW-VW Automobile Co., Ltd., the other joint venture of Volkswagen in the country.
In 1983, the first Santana rolled off the production line in Shanghai. Till now, its sales has reached 3.21 million vehicles. From January to April 2009, SVW sold 56,012 Santanas, including 16,765 units in April alone, citing the data by the China Association of Automobile Manufacturers (CAAM), indicating that the market still has a strong demand for the car model.

Toyota Motor Corp has received more than 80,000 pre-sale orders for the new Prius in Japan, Executive Vice President Akio Toyoda said on Monday, unveiling the third-generation model.
Toyota, the world’s biggest automaker, said it was targeting monthly sales of 10,000 units in Japan.
The car, which will start at 2.05 million yen ($21,620), will be sold alongside the entry-level grade of the second-generation Prius, which will cost 1.89 million yen, equal to Honda Motor Co’s new Insight hybrid.

Toyota Motor Corp. has hit a pothole in China, where its failure to anticipate booming demand for small cars is depressing sales as rivals like General Motors Corp. report sharp gains.
The sales slump is a blow to the world’s biggest auto maker because China is the only major global auto market still growing. The problem adds to weakness in other markets for Toyota, which is expected Friday to report big losses for the year through March 31.
Toyota’s China sales in the first quarter of 2009 fell 17% from a year earlier to 125,743 vehicles, even as the total Chinese market, fueled by rising demand for small cars, grew 4% to 2.7 million vehicles. GM’s sales gained 17% to 363,317 vehicles, including commercial microminivans made by SAIC GM Wuling Automobile Co., in which GM holds a minority stake.

S?O PAULO, Brazil — The second Chinese brand is about to land in Brazil. The first is Hafei, working through local distributor Effa Motors, which started selling small vehicles in Brazil in late 2008, notably the small M100 light commercial vehicle. Chery will hit the Brazil market in July with the Tiggo SUV.
Like the Effa-Hafei vehicles, the Tiggo will be imported from neighboring Uruguay, where China's third automaker, Chery, has set up an assembly operation. Under Mercosur trade rules, the Chinese car is exempt from import tariffs, making it truly price-competitive in this market at the equivalent of about $23,300.

W?RTHERSEE, Austria — Volkswagen on Wednesday announced the dual world premiere of the Golf GTI W?rthersee '09 and the Polo W?rthersee '09.
The special-edition VW Golf GTI W?rthersee '09 is painted in Firespark Metallic with 19-inch alloy spoke wheels and smoked LED taillights. The cabin gets brushed aluminum trim and redesigned sport seats. Power comes from the 2.0-liter TSI with 207 horsepower. VW said the car has a top speed of 148 mph and accelerates from zero to 60 mph in less than 6.9 seconds.
The Polo concept gets a Flash Red paint job accented by two black rally stripes. Black 18-inch alloy wheels round out the cosmetic touches on the outside.

AUBURN HILLS, Michigan — Chrysler LLC announced that it will name the former head of Duracell International and Borden Chemical, C. Robert Kidder, to chairman of Chrysler Group LLC, succeeding Robert Nardelli. On April 30 Nardelli made known his intention to depart Chrysler and return to Cerberus Capital Management as an advisor. Kidder's appointment will be come effective after the Fiat “global alliance” acquisition is complete.
Nardelli praised Kidder's “accomplished business background.” Kidder, who lives in Ohio, is currently chairman and CEO of 3Stone Advisors, an investment firm that focuses on “clean-tech companies,” according to Chrysler.

DETROIT — General Motors says it has narrowed down the potential buyers of Saab to three. In court papers filed this week, GM said it has talked to 10 suitors and has decided to spend the rest of May talking to three of those before choosing the “final candidate.” Meanwhile, General Motors Europe reportedly has received a trio of bids for Opel. The automaker isn't saying who these bidders are or if there is any overlap.
